Foundation Overview
Based in Broomfield, CO, The Culver Family Foundation Inc has awarded 22 grants totaling $184,600 to organizations in North Carolina, Colorado and 2 other states across the US. Individual grants range from $100 to $50,000, with a median award of $1,000.

Geographic Focus
59% of grants are awarded in Colorado, with additional funding distributed across 3 other locations. The foundation balances regional focus with broader geographic diversity. Within Colorado, funding concentrates in Boulder (62%), Longmont (23%), Fort Morgan (8%).

Form 990-PF Research Tips
- Review Part XV for detailed grant recipient information and funding purposes
- Check Part I for total assets, annual giving amounts, and payout requirements
- Examine Part VIII for key personnel compensation and board structure
- Look for trends across multiple years to understand giving patterns
